蛋蛋赞.json 8.3 KB


  1. //写法思路来自biubiu影院,海阔视界,xpath筛选。
  2. //项目魔改至github开源仓库https://github.com/Tangsan99999/TvJar中的XBiubiu.java文件,
  3. //本文档为完整模板,实际情况可按规则写法删去不需要的。
  4. {
  5. //规则名
  6. "title": "20220917",
  7. //作者
  8. "author": "20220917",
  9. //请求头UA,不填则默认okhttp/3.12.11,可填MOBILE_UA或PC_UA使用内置的手机版或电脑版UA
  10. //习惯查看手机源码写建议用手机版UA,习惯查看PC版源码写建议用电脑版UA
  11. "UserAgent":"PC_UA",
  12. //请求头Referer参数,如果只是播放页需要,填WebView即可引用播放页的链接作嗅探Referer参数。
  13. //一般很少用,留空或删除
  14. "Referer":"",
  15. //是否开启获取首页数据,0关闭,1开启
  16. "homeContent":"1",
  17. //分类链接起始页码,禁止负数和含小数点。
  18. "firstpage": "0",
  19. //分类链接,{cateId}是分类,{catePg}是页码,第一页没有页码的可以这样写 第二页链接[firstPage=第一页的链接]
  20. "class_url": "https://www.dandanzan10.top/{cateId}/{class}-{area}-{year}-{catePg}-{by}.html",
  21. //分类名,分类1&分类2&分类3
  22. "class_name": "电影",
  23. //分类名替换词,替换词1&替换词2&替换词3,替换词包含英文&的用两个中文&&代替,示例:&&id=0&&&id=1
  24. "class_value": "dianying",
  25. //筛选数据,json格式,参考xpath的筛选写法
  26. "filterdata":{"dianying": [
  27. {
  28. "key": "class",
  29. "name": "分类",
  30. "value": [
  31. {"n": "全部","v": ""},
  32. {"n": "剧情","v": "剧情"},
  33. {"n": "喜剧","v": "喜剧"},
  34. {"n": "动作","v": "动作"},
  35. {"n": "爱情","v": "爱情"},
  36. {"n": "科幻","v": "科幻"},
  37. {"n": "悬疑","v": "悬疑"},
  38. {"n": "惊悚","v": "惊悚"},
  39. {"n": "恐怖","v": "恐怖"},
  40. {"n": "犯罪","v": "犯罪"},
  41. {"n": "音乐","v": "音乐"},
  42. {"n": "歌舞","v": "歌舞"},
  43. {"n": "传记","v": "传记"},
  44. {"n": "历史","v": "历史"},
  45. {"n": "战争","v": "战争"},
  46. {"n": "西部","v": "西部"},
  47. {"n": "奇幻","v": "奇幻"},
  48. {"n": "冒险","v": "冒险"},
  49. {"n": "灾难","v": "灾难"},
  50. {"n": "武侠","v": "武侠"}
  51. ]},
  52. {
  53. "key": "area",
  54. "name": "地区",
  55. "value": [
  56. {"n": "全部","v": ""},
  57. {"n": "大陆","v": "中国大陆"},
  58. {"n": "美国","v": "美国"},
  59. {"n": "香港","v": "香港"},
  60. {"n": "台湾","v": "台湾"},
  61. {"n": "日本","v": "日本"},
  62. {"n": "韩国","v": "韩国"},
  63. {"n": "英国","v": "英国"},
  64. {"n": "法国","v": "法国"},
  65. {"n": "德国","v": "德国"},
  66. {"n": "意大利","v": "意大利"},
  67. {"n": "西班牙","v": "西班牙"},
  68. {"n": "印度","v": "印度"},
  69. {"n": "泰国","v": "泰国"},
  70. {"n": "俄罗斯","v": "俄罗斯"},
  71. {"n": "加拿大","v": "加拿大"},
  72. {"n": "澳大利亚","v": "澳大利亚"},
  73. {"n": "爱尔兰","v": "爱尔兰"},
  74. {"n": "瑞典","v": "瑞典"},
  75. {"n": "巴西","v": "巴西"},
  76. {"n": "丹麦","v": "丹麦"}
  77. ]
  78. },
  79. {
  80. "key": "year",
  81. "name": "年份",
  82. "value": [
  83. {"n": "全部","v": ""},
  84. {"n": "2022","v": "2022"},
  85. {"n": "2021","v": "2021"},
  86. {"n": "2020","v": "2020"},
  87. {"n": "2019","v": "2019"},
  88. {"n": "2018","v": "2018"},
  89. {"n": "2017","v": "2017"},
  90. {"n": "2016","v": "2016"},
  91. {"n": "2015","v": "2015"},
  92. {"n": "2014","v": "2014"},
  93. {"n": "2013","v": "2013"},
  94. {"n": "2012","v": "2012"},
  95. {"n": "2011","v": "2011"},
  96. {"n": "2010","v": "2010"},
  97. {"n": "2009","v": "2009"},
  98. {"n": "2008","v": "2008"},
  99. {"n": "2007","v": "2007"},
  100. {"n": "2006","v": "2006"},
  101. {"n": "2005","v": "2005"},
  102. {"n": "2004","v": "2004"},
  103. {"n": "2003","v": "2003"},
  104. {"n": "2002","v": "2002"},
  105. {"n": "更早","v": "1__2001"}
  106. ]
  107. },
  108. {
  109. "key": "by",
  110. "name": "排序",
  111. "value": [
  112. {"n": "全部","v": ""},
  113. {"n": "时间","v": "newstime"},
  114. {"n": "人气","v": "onclick"},
  115. {"n": "评分","v": "rating"}
  116. ]
  117. }
  118. ]},
  119. //分类页面截取数据模式,0为json,1为普通网页。
  120. "cat_mode": "1",
  121. //分类json列表数组定位,最多支持3层,能力有限,不是所有页面都能支持
  122. "catjsonlist": "",
  123. //分类json片单图片
  124. "catjsonpic": "",
  125. //分类json片单标题
  126. "catjsonname": "",
  127. //分类json片单链接
  128. "catjsonid": "",
  129. //分类json片单副标题
  130. "catjsonstitle":"",
  131. //分类是否二次截取
  132. "cat_YN_twice": "1",
  133. //分类二次截取前
  134. "cat_twice_pre": "class=\"lists-content\"",
  135. //分类二次截取后
  136. "cat_twice_suf": "class=\"pagination",
  137. //分类数组截取前
  138. "cat_arr_pre": "<li",
  139. //分类数组截取后
  140. "cat_arr_suf": "/a>",
  141. //分类截取片单图片,截取前缀&&截取后缀
  142. "cat_pic": "src=\"&&\"",
  143. //分类截取片单标题,截取前缀&&截取后缀
  144. "cat_title": "alt=\"&&\"",
  145. //分类截取片单副标题,截取前缀&&截取后缀
  146. "cat_subtitle": "class=\"countrie\"&&</div",
  147. //分类截取片单链接,截取前缀&&截取后缀
  148. "cat_url": "href=\"&&\"",
  149. //分类片单链接补前缀
  150. "cat_prefix": "https://www.dandanzan10.top",
  151. //分类片单链接补后缀
  152. "cat_suffix": "",
  153. //搜索链接,搜索关键字用{wd}表示,post请求的最后面加;post
  154. //POST链接示例 http://www.lezhutv.com/index.php?m=vod-search;post
  155. "search_url": "https://www.dandanzan10.top/so/{wd}-{wd}--.html",
  156. //POST搜索body,填写搜索关键字的键值,一般常见的是searchword和wd,不是POST搜索的可留空或删除。
  157. "sea_PtBody":"",
  158. //搜索模式,0为json搜索,只支持列表在list数组里的,其它为网页截取。
  159. "search_mode": "1",
  160. //搜索json列表数组定位,不填默认内置list,最多支持3层,能力有限,不是所有页面都能支持。
  161. "jsonlist": "",
  162. //搜索json片单图片
  163. "jsonpic": "",
  164. //搜索json片单标题
  165. "jsonname": "",
  166. //搜索json片单链接
  167. "jsonid": "",
  168. //json片单副标题,这个很少有,预留着
  169. "jsonstitle":"",
  170. //搜索是否二次截取
  171. "sea_YN_twice": "1",
  172. //搜索二次截取前
  173. "sea_twice_pre": "class=\"lists-content\"",
  174. //搜索二次截取后
  175. "sea_twice_suf": "class=\"pagination",
  176. //搜索数组前缀
  177. "sea_arr_pre": "<li",
  178. //搜索数组后缀
  179. "sea_arr_suf": "/a>",
  180. //搜索片单图片,截取前缀&&截取后缀
  181. "sea_pic": "src=\"&&\"",
  182. //搜索片单标题,截取前缀&&截取后缀
  183. "sea_title": "alt=\"&&\"",
  184. //搜索片单链接,截取前缀&&截取后缀
  185. "sea_url": "href=\"&&\"",
  186. //搜索片单链接补前缀
  187. "search_prefix": "https://www.dandanzan10.top",
  188. //搜索片单链接补后缀,这个一般json搜索的需要
  189. "search_suffix": "",
  190. //搜索副标题,截取前缀&&截取后缀
  191. "sea_subtitle": "class=\"countrie\"&&</div",
  192. //片单链接是否直接播放,0否,1分类片单链接直接播放,2详情选集链接直接播放。
  193. //设置成直接播放后,后面3个参数请注意该留空的请务必留空。
  194. "force_play": "1",
  195. //直接播放链接补前缀
  196. "play_prefix": "",
  197. //直接播放链接补后缀,设置为#isVideo=true#可强制识别为视频链接
  198. "play_suffix": "",
  199. //直接播放链接设置请求头,只对直链视频有效,每一组用#分开
  200. "play_header": ""
  201. }